What Is a Sofa Sleeper Couch?

A sofa sleeper couch is a multifunctional piece of furniture that can be transformed into a sleeping area for guests. Contrary to futons include a mattress built right in the frame of the sofa.

Before you purchase a sofa bed, you should consider the way you'll make use of it. The kind of mattress you pick is also crucial.

Style

A sofa sleeper couch is an excellent way to accommodate guests staying overnight without sacrificing your living space. You can pick from a variety of mattress and frame types to find the style that fits your needs.

If you're looking to ensure that your sleeper sofa lasts, choose one with a solid frame made from furniture-grade plywood or hardwoods that have been dried and kiln-fired. The mattress should be made of a durable material like steel or spring wood. Memory foam is a great option because it offers relief from pressure points and feels cooler than innerspring mattresses. Other options include polyurethane foam, gel memory foam, and latex which has a bouncier feel than memory foam and is ecofriendly.

The fabric you pick for your sleeper sofa is an important thing to think about. Choose a fabric that matches your style and complements the rest of your room. For example, if you have a rustic or country design, you might want to consider a sofa made of natural materials and neutral colors. If you have children or pets choose fabrics with performance that are spill-resistant and easy to clean.

If you're considering buying a sofa with a pull-out feature, it's an excellent idea to test the mechanism by sitting on the double chaise couch and pulling on the handle or bar that raises the mattress. The more easy the pull-out process is, the better, because you won't be straining yourself. Some models come with simple locks to open the bed and others have a power mechanism for easier opening. Comfort

If you plan to use a sofa-sleeper couch as a standard piece of furniture in your living room, it must offer both the comfort of sitting as well as to sleep. It is crucial to choose one with cushioned seats that are comfortable to sit on and can be easily converted into a bed for the perfect night's rest. The kind and quantity of filling in the cushion can affect the way it is, so you might want to play with a few different sofa beds prior to making your purchase.

The size of the mattress will determine the size of the sofa bed will take up when it is opened. Most sofa sleepers come with mattresses that are queen-sized, but there are models that have twin-sized mattresses and even full-sized mattresses. If you choose a queen-sized mattress, look for one that has a removable cover to make cleaning a breeze and to ensure that the sheets you use will fit perfectly.

Sleepers with a pull-out feature typically have a mattress that easily folds away from the cushions of the seat, and some have locks to hold the mattress in position. Sleeper sofas can be easily operated but require more space for floor.

Mattress-less sofa beds require that the couch cushions function as a sleeping surface. They are, therefore, less comfortable for guests as compared to a bed that has an attached mattress. If you decide to purchase a sofa that has this design, be sure to test the sofa in person prior to making your purchase.

No matter if you choose traditional pull-outs or a mattress-less sofa, it's essential to examine the frame and construction of the sofa in addition to the quality of the mattress. The frame must be strong and well-built, and the mattress must be firm and comfortable for sleep.
